  • Patent number: 9958840
    Abstract: A controller for controlling a system includes a non-transitory computer-readable memory storing data for an operation and a control of the system and at least one processor operatively connected to the memory for determining a control signal transitioning a state of the system from a current state to a next state. At least two instances of the data are stored in the memory with different precisions defined by numbers of bits storing the instance in the memory. The processor determines the control signal using the instances of the data with the different precisions.
